Discussion of Arlington County Change of Government Petition Drive. Tom Yager mentioned that the petition to change the county form of government, which has been endorsed by the Arlington local, was initiated by the Arlington police and fire fighters' unions. It was predicated by the lack responsiveness on the part of Arlington County government to their concerns and would replace the present at large election of county board members with a district system. Tamar mentioned that the petition drive appears to be professionally organized and has a paid petition coordinator. She therefore believes it stands a good chance of success.
